dextra sistemas - vivenciando scrum

19
Soluções de Software Sistemas e aplicações sob medida para as necessidades do seu negócio. Vivenciando SCRUM Experiência e desafios

Upload: leandro-guimaraes

Post on 06-Jul-2015

627 views

Category:

Business


0 download

DESCRIPTION

Temos experimentado Scrum há um bom tempo tendo, atualmente, 100% dos nosso projetos sendo desenvolvidos neste estilo: de sistemas para órgãos públicos a sistemas bancários. Nosso objetivo é relatar os principais desafios enfrentados durante a implantação, os benefícios obtidos e, também, o que temos experimentado de novidades nesse mundo agile.

TRANSCRIPT

Page 1: Dextra Sistemas - Vivenciando SCRUM

Soluções de Software

Sistemas e aplicações sob medida para asnecessidades do seu negócio.

Vivenciando SCRUMExperiência e desafios

Page 2: Dextra Sistemas - Vivenciando SCRUM

Leandro Guimarães

Page 3: Dextra Sistemas - Vivenciando SCRUM

A Dextra

Page 4: Dextra Sistemas - Vivenciando SCRUM

A Dextra e o SCRUM

Início em 2007 em um projeto já em andamento

– Iniciativa de colaboradores;

Aplicação em um projeto piloto

– By the book: com todos os papéis, cerimônias e afins;

– Em menos da metade do tempo previsto, o core do sistema estava entregue e em produção

– Em torno de 20% das funcionalidades especificadas;

Atualmente: 100% dos nossos projetos “rodando” SCRUM

– Iniciativa privada;

– Órgãos governamentais

Page 5: Dextra Sistemas - Vivenciando SCRUM

Transição

Misto de sensações

– Estamos utilizando algo novo!

– Parece ser muito bom mesmo!

– Será que vai funcionar?!

– Mas aqui é diferente...

Minha primeira vez

– Escopo entregue completamente diferente do escopo original;

– Cliente extremamente satisfeito com o resultado;

– Eu com a cabeça “pirada”.

Page 6: Dextra Sistemas - Vivenciando SCRUM

Papéis

Page 7: Dextra Sistemas - Vivenciando SCRUM

Time

Time

Multidisciplinar;

Responsável pelo DONE;

Não existem mitos nem verdades absolutas;

Não existe hierarquia;

Sempre presente em reuniões com o cliente;

Espaço para inovarem;

Page 8: Dextra Sistemas - Vivenciando SCRUM

PO

Product Owner

PO interno;

Representa o cliente dentro do projeto;

Priorização de atividades;

Conduz o planejamento;

Participa da retrospectiva;

Elabora cenários de testes e critérios de aceitação;

Gerencia o backlog;

Page 9: Dextra Sistemas - Vivenciando SCRUM

Gerente de Projetos

Gerente de Projetos

Responsável pelo acompanhamento do projeto

– Indicadores de custo, prazo;

Participa da retrospectiva;

Relacionamento com o cliente;

Relacionamento com a alta gerência / diretoria;

Page 10: Dextra Sistemas - Vivenciando SCRUM

Mas...

Cadê o SCRUM MASTER?!

Page 11: Dextra Sistemas - Vivenciando SCRUM

Scrum Master

Page 12: Dextra Sistemas - Vivenciando SCRUM

Atividades

Registro eletrônico das estórias: informações de acompanhamento para clientes;

Elaboração dos cenários de testes;

Acompanhamento das atividades via quadro SCRUM;

Acompanhamento eletrônico das atividades não foi eficiente;

Entregas sempre no fim de cada SPRINT (10 dias úteis);

Page 13: Dextra Sistemas - Vivenciando SCRUM

Processo

Page 14: Dextra Sistemas - Vivenciando SCRUM

Diversidade

Page 15: Dextra Sistemas - Vivenciando SCRUM

PDCA

Questão de SOBREVIVÊNCIA!

Page 16: Dextra Sistemas - Vivenciando SCRUM

PDCA

Page 17: Dextra Sistemas - Vivenciando SCRUM

Desafios

E os testes? Como ficam?

– Testes automatizados;

– TDD e BDD;

– “Equipe de testes” se aproximando cada vez mais do PO e do Time;

– Todo mundo vai precisar programar?!

Page 18: Dextra Sistemas - Vivenciando SCRUM

Desafios

SCRUM Master

– Papel ainda “nebuloso”;

– Será que precisamos ter uma

receita de SCRUM Master?

Times Remotos

– Como “digitalizar” a dinâmica do dia a dia?

Projetos de Suporte

– Scrum parece não se adequar muito.

– Kanban + valores SCRUM?

Page 19: Dextra Sistemas - Vivenciando SCRUM

Fale conosco

www.dextra.com.br

[email protected]

São Paulo 11 2824.6722

Campinas 19 3256.6722